Hi. I will shortly be upgrading to a new computer running XP. I have been using FP 2000 and several other upgrade versions (97, 98 etc) dating back to orig. purchase of FP for W95 on floppies!!! So what is the best way to install FP 2000 or even 2002 upgrade on my new computer? Do I have to install my first version - Frontpage for w95 via floppies first? Any ideas out there? Thanks!




dpav29 -> RE: XP/upgrade version of FP2000...best way? (12/31/2001 9:56:47)

I went from 98 to 2000 then to 2002. I guess it depends on whether you have the 2002 upgrade or full version. If you have the full version, just install it. It'll ask you whether you want to save or uninstall any previous versions.

With 2002, when you open a web, you can either open it live (from the web server) or from your local drive. Either way, your previous work will be there.

--I guess my question was really whether I should buy an upgrade or full version if the upgrade is going to be a huge hassle.--

I installed the FP2002 upgrade on my computer here at work, and it never asked for the previous version's disk (what normally happens if the program does not see a previous version). Like you, we have upgraded since FP97.

BTW, FP2000 or 2002 should work fine with XP.
